Identity & symbols

Language

English is the official language; the alphabet is the standard Latin alphabet with no special characters.

Culture

Cultural markers include Caribbean music, local art, and signs of British influence; look for Caymanian flags and local festivals.

Miscellaneous

Look for distinctive palm trees, beach scenes, and specific local businesses or landmarks such as Seven Mile Beach.

Environment & landscape

Environment

The landscape includes sandy beaches, tropical vegetation, and a flat terrain; the islands are surrounded by clear blue waters.

Infrastructure

Architectural styles reflect Caribbean influences, with colorful buildings, wooden structures, and a mix of modern and colonial designs.

Coverage

True

Foliage

Common tree types include coconut palms, sea grape trees, and various tropical hardwoods; grasses are typically lush and green.

Topography

The topography is mostly flat with some low limestone hills and coastal cliffs.

Roads & transportation

Cars

Vehicle registration plates are white with a blue border; they include a combination of letters and numbers.

Driving

Vehicles drive on the left side of the road.

Signs

Road signs are in English and often feature blue and white colors; they include international symbols and are relatively simple in design.

Stop

Stop signs read 'STOP' in Cayman Islands.

Bollards

Bollards are typically standard cylindrical shapes and may be painted in bright colors for visibility.

Poles

Utility poles are often made of wood and may have transformers attached, resembling those found in other Caribbean regions.
